Anatomy of a wooden mandoline slicer: parts that matter
The frame material and finish determine long-term durability: beech and maple are dense and wear-resistant; walnut adds visual contrast; bamboo gives a renewable option that resists splitting when finished properly.
Look for food-safe finishes such as mineral oil, beeswax blends, or FDA-approved sealants that penetrate wood without forming a brittle surface film.
Blade systems vary: fixed stainless-steel blades set into the frame offer rigidity; interchangeable inserts allow multiple blade geometries without replacing the whole unit; separately sold julienne attachments expand capability.
Key safety and stability features include non-slip feet, an angled slicing surface to control food travel, a sturdy finger guard or pusher, and a locking mechanism for safe storage and blade insertion.
Blade types and materials explained
Straight slicing blades produce smooth, continuous cuts suitable for potatoes, apples and tomatoes; adjustable thickness blades let you dial in slices from paper-thin to chunky.
Serrated or crinkle blades create texture for chips and garnishes and cut soft items without crushing; julienne knives produce matchstick strips for slaws and garnishes.
Blades are usually high-carbon stainless steel or fully stainless alloys; high-carbon steel sharpens to a finer edge but needs more care to resist corrosion, while stainless steel resists rust at the cost of slightly slower edge retention.
Edge retention, corrosion resistance and blade hardness directly affect slice consistency and how often you’ll need to sharpen or replace blades.
Slicing performance: cuts, thickness control and consistency
Expect uniform slices across hard and medium vegetables—potato, cucumber, carrot—when the blade is sharp and the frame is rigid; softer produce may need a firmer push or a guard to avoid tearing.
Adjustable thickness mechanisms come in two common types: micrometer-style sliders for continuous, precise adjustment, and stepped settings that snap to preset thicknesses for repeatable cuts.
Micrometer sliders give the best control for paper-thin techniques; stepped settings are faster and more reliable for batch work where repeatability beats micro-adjustment.
Specialty cuts: julienne attachments reliably produce uniform matchsticks; waffle or crinkle cuts need precise flipping technique and stable blade geometry to avoid jagged or inconsistent patterns.
Tip: sharpen blades regularly and use a consistent feed pressure to maintain slice uniformity across long prep sessions.
Safety-first techniques for using a wooden mandoline slicer
Always use the included finger guard or a food holder; never push food with bare fingertips directly toward the blade.
Cut-resistant gloves provide a second line of defense and are inexpensive insurance for frequent mandoline users.
Stabilize the unit by using non-slip feet, a damp kitchen towel, or a silicone mat beneath the mandoline to prevent movement during aggressive slicing.
Insert and remove blades with the unit locked and the cutting edge pointed away from your hands; store blades in a sheath or inside the frame to prevent accidental cuts.
Keep mandolines out of reach of children and lock any adjustable parts before stowing to prevent unintentional exposure to sharp edges.
Cleaning, maintenance and blade care for wooden mandolines
Most wooden mandolines require hand-washing only; rinse the blade and wipe the wood with a damp cloth, then dry thoroughly to prevent warping and mold growth.
Avoid prolonged soaking and dishwashers; excess moisture will raise the wood grain and can crack finishes over time.
Reapply food-grade mineral oil or a beeswax/mineral oil paste every few months or when the wood looks dry; rub oil into the grain, let it penetrate, then wipe off excess.
Sharpen blades with a fine ceramic rod or whetstone following the original bevel angle; hone lightly after each few uses and sharpen fully when you notice tearing or uneven slices.
To prevent rust, dry blades immediately after washing and store with a thin coating of food-grade oil if the unit will sit unused for more than a week.
Comparing wood mandoline slicers with plastic and metal alternatives
Durability: wooden frames are often repairable—minor cracks can be filled and refinished—while thin plastics can warp permanently and full-metal units can dent but rarely crack.
Hygiene trade-offs: wood is slightly porous, so choose sealed finishes and clean promptly to reduce bacterial risk; plastics and stainless steel are non-porous and easier to sanitize thoroughly.
Weight and storage: wooden mandolines are heavier than many plastics, which enhances stability but makes transport harder; metal mandolines can be bulky but often fold or disassemble for storage.
Cost: expect artisan wooden models to sit above entry-level plastic units but below top-tier commercial stainless-steel machines; price reflects craftsmanship, blade quality and included accessories.
